Q: Is 6,040,752 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 6,040,752 is a composite number.

Why is 6,040,752 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 6,040,752 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 16 24 48 317 397 634 794 951 1,191 1,268 1,588 1,902 2,382 2,536 3,176 3,804 4,764 5,072 6,352 7,608 9,528 15,216 19,056 125,849 251,698 377,547 503,396 755,094 1,006,792 1,510,188 2,013,584 3,020,376 and 6,040,752, with no remainder.

Since 6,040,752 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,040,752, it is a composite number.
